Royalty-free stock photo ID: 581937442
Field of wild rose or wild rose flowers with green leaves at closeup range.
Related keywords
Categories: Nature, Parks/Outdoor
Royalty-free stock photo ID: 581937442
Related keywords
Categories: Nature, Parks/Outdoor